South Africa - Migration Industry
Abstract
The focus of the Migration Industry research in South Africa is on the multiple actors and institutions
that together make it possible for an individual to migrate. These include border control agencies,
skills training centres, health testing and certification centres, recruitment agencies and brokers, aid
agencies, as well as faith based organ
isations and NGOs - that together make it possible for an individual to migrate. By understanding how migrants and brokers connect with networks of agencies and individuals involved in facilitating migration, our understanding of the negotiations and power
relations that facilitate and control migration is improved
